Amos Blasingame 1919 - 2007

Amos Blasingame of Texarkana, Bowie County, TX was born on December 31, 1919, and died at age 87 years old on May 13, 2007. Amos Blasingame was buried at Rock Island National Cemetery Section M Site 2179 Bldg 118 - Rock Island Arsenal, in Rock Island, Il.

In 1919, in the year that Amos Blasingame was born, in the summer and early autumn, race riots erupted in 26 U.S. cities, resulting in hundreds of deaths and even more people being badly hurt. In most cases, African-Americans were the victims. It was called the "Red Summer". Men who were returning from World War I needed jobs and there was competition for those jobs among the races. Tension was heightened by the use by many companies of blacks as strikebreakers.

In 1932, Amos was just 13 years old when on February 27th, actress Elizabeth Taylor was born in London. Her parents were Americans living in London and when she was 7, the family moved to Los Angeles. Her first small part in a movie was in There's One Born Every Minute in 1942 but her first starring role was in National Velvet in 1944. She became as famous for her 8 marriages (to 7 people) as she was for her beauty and films.
